在Ubuntu20.10中启动Thunderbird时,会显示一条错误消息
XML Parsing Error: undefined entity
Location: chrome://messenger/content/messenger.xhtml
Line Number 905, Column 3:
<key id="openLightningKey"
--^什么都不会发生。但是,可以使用命令行命令以“安全模式”启动雷鸟。
thunderbird -safe-mode我安装了一些语言包,德语,英语(CA),英语(GB),法语和瑞典语。
我如何使雷鸟开始确定从应用菜单?
发布于 2020-10-28 17:26:25
在安装了Mozilla的官方语言包之后,我也遇到了同样的问题。在关闭和重新启动雷鸟之后,我看到了一个弹出式窗口,与你发布的消息完全一样,无法让雷鸟再次运行。
基于这个(德语)论坛线程:https://www.thunderbird-mail.de/forum/thread/85658-thunderbird-startet-nicht-bzw-gibt-fehlermeldung-nur-im-safemode-m%C3%B6glich/?postID=468615中的消息,其他人在最近安装或更新了语言包之后也遇到了同样的问题。
我通过将违规文件(在我的例子中是langpack-en-GB@thunderbird.mozilla.org.xpi)移出Thunderbird的extensions目录,从而解决了这个问题。在我的系统中,我的所有雷鸟设置,包括导出目录,都位于/home/MYUSER/.thunderbird/RANDOMSTRING.default。
发布于 2020-11-03 05:29:53
被接受的答案并没有帮助我,但这确实帮了我:
thunderbird --safe-mode在命令行/shell/终端中启动thunderbirdthunderbird。对于不想要或者可以在配置目录中移动文件的用户来说,这可能是一个更优雅的解决方案。
发布于 2020-11-09 14:13:32
我设法在Ubuntu20.10上解决了这个问题,从thunderbird --safe-mode开始,删除了所有语言包(菜单“->”语言“加载项”)。请注意,在我的系统中,我无法将它们全部删除,因为其中一些是从Debian包中安装的。但事实证明,后者并没有造成任何问题,而且我能够在没有安全模式的情况下启动雷鸟。
如果您还想从Debian包中删除安装的语言包,可以通过运行(根据计算机上安装的语言进行调整):
$ apt purge thunderbird-locale-de thunderbird-locale-en这样做之后,语言包的列表应该是空的,并且您应该能够正常启动Thunderbird。
https://askubuntu.com/questions/1287732
复制相似问题